Gwen Stefani – 15th Anniversary

After achieving global success as a performer, songwriter and frontwoman for No Doubt, Gwen Stefani released her first solo album – Love.Angel.Music.Baby. – on November 23, 2004. To celebrate the 15th anniversary of its release, the album has been remastered by five-time GRAMMY® nominee Chris Gehringer (Rihanna, Drake, Lady Gaga) of Sterling Sound.
